Job Description:

We are looking for a Full Time Permanent Horticultural Manager to join the team in our Weaver Vale Garden Centre. This is a Full time position with regular weekend working so flexibility is a must.

Job Responsibility:

  • Managing the outdoor plant area
  • Manage department to achieve sales and profit targets
  • Motivate team to maximise opportunities and offer highest standards of customer service
  • Planning & supervising staff resources for daily running of the department
  • Ensuring all stock is clearly and accurately priced and always looking fresh
  • Plant stock replenishment and merchandising to create fabulous plant displays with clear and accurate POS
  • Develop the team to look after and care for plants
  • Advise customers on suitable plants and products
  • Manager regular cleaning and housekeeping tasks
  • As a Garden Centre Duty Manager, take on wider responsibilities for managing the Garden Centre
  • Work with the management team to support duty cover and Centre business priorities

Requirements:

  • Qualified horticulturalist
  • Retail management experience
  • Friendly, engaging personality
  • Genuine love for retail and customer service
  • Knowledgeable and passionate about plants and plant related products
  • Successful retail manager who can coach and develop their team
  • Strong communicator
  • Commercially aware to achieve sales and profit targets
  • Flexibility for regular weekend working
What we offer:
  • Competitive rates of pay
  • Healthy work/life balance with no evening work
  • Access to 100s of retail and lifestyle experiences and discounts
  • Health Cash Plans
  • Generous staff discounts
  • 6 weeks Annual Leave per year
  • Free Parking
